Key blanks
The key blank is a basic part of the lock that is used to cut a new key. The key blank can be made of nickel-silver or brass and comes with a variety of grooves and cuts. The key blank is then made into the shape of a house key. The key blank may then be further cut and shaped to include the other features that are required for a particular type of lock, like pins or notches. This process can be done by hand or the aid of a machine.
Today, there are many different kinds of keys. They include barrel keys, bit keys, cylinders keys and flat keys. Each one is utilized for different purposes and has its unique features. Understanding the differences is essential for a precise key duplication. This is an essential ability for locksmiths, since they must be able to identify the correct key blank and ensure that it will fit inside the lock.
The majority of key blanks are designed to fit a particular type of lock. They can also be branded with a logo or a phrase. They could also be branded with a unique identification number, which helps locate other blanks that are suitable for duplication.
The shoulder stop and grooves on the key head are unique to the lock manufacturer. They also influence how the key is fitted into the locking mechanism. The blades and tips of a key could also be used to cut and trace. The most common method of identifying a key blank is by using its identification number, if it has one, to identify the lock's manufacturer and then locate other blanks suitable to duplicate.
If a key is not stamped with the words "Do not duplicate" or "It is against the law to copy" It is generally legal to duplicate a key in all countries. However it is crucial to know that these marks are not legally binding in all locations, and some trade organisations have ethical standards that prevent their members from duplicated keys.

Scan tool
A scan tool is a device that plugs into a vehicle's OBDII port and sends data from the vehicle's onboard computer. The devices offer a variety of features that vary by price and intended use. Consumer-grade scanners provide basic troubleshooting and code definitions. In contrast, professional-grade scanners have advanced knowledge bases and integrated testing equipment. Furthermore, the best scanners have a suite of features that make it simple to repair and identify failed components.
A key programmer scan tool is used to make an electronic car key by connecting to the car's diagnostic port and sending commands to the computer to enter programming mode. This enables the car to read and write the data from the new key into its memory. The car can also be programmed to erase the existing key data from its computer in the event of need.
Some scan tools are designed specifically for get more info a specific car manufacturer, while others are compatible with a variety of brands. They can be used to diagnose various systems including the engine, transmission, ABS and more. They might also have service reset functions, such as oil reset or SAS. Certain models can even program the immobilizer systems of certain vehicles.
If you are looking for a multi-system scanner, ensure that it supports both OBD2 and OBD1. Some models even support heavy diesel cars. Other models can read a live data stream and display graphs. They can also calibrate or reprogram modules based on certain parameters.
